The Indian Women’s Association Moscow kicked off its new season with a fun-filled excursion to Kolomenskoye Museum Reserve on September 6, 2023. Over 40 IWA members participated in the event on this bright and sunny day. The ladies were divided into two groups and a guided tour to the House of Peter I and Tsar Alexei Mikhailovich’s palace was conducted by English speaking guides dressed in traditional Imperial Russian attire.
We began the tour at the Church of Our Lady of Kazan, a mid-17th century architectural monument crowned with five blue onion-shaped domes with golden stars. We then walked on to the House of Peter I. The modest wooden house serves as a memorial museum to Peter the Great. Another short walk took us to the edge of Moscow River where stood, in all its white glory, the Church of the Ascension. We then boarded our buses for the recreated Palace of Tsar Alexei Mikhailovich, where we saw what his throne rooms, his bedchamber and his bath would have looked like.
We concluded our picnic at the café adjacent to the palace with some piping hot Russian cuisine and equally hot gossip. New members were welcomed, some old members were bid goodbye, and a new IWA - Moscow season was declared open. A big thank you to all members who took part in the event.
